Top 5 in Russia: SPbPU in THE WUR 2025 ranking
The British agency Times Higher Education has published the results of the World University Ranking 2025. St. Petersburg Polytechnic took 5th place in the ranking among all Russian universities.

Peter the Great St. Petersburg Polytechnic University took 5th place in the national ranking of Russian universities, and in the overall ranking of world universities it is in the group of places 501-600. Polytechnic University’s work on knowledge transfer was particularly effective: the university received twice as many points for the number of registered patents for inventions as a year earlier.
In addition, SPbPU received a high score for its international activities. Also, compared to the indicators of the same ranking last year, the income from research and development work in relation to the number of teaching staff increased by 5%.
Now our focus on applied research and development is already beginning to be reflected in international rankings. Today, it is partnership with industry and technology transfer that are our strengths, which give us an advantage in the competition. However, publication activity, especially in terms of high quality articles, where applied knowledge is in high demand, can also be one of our areas of development
, comments Andrei Rudskoi, Rector of SPbPU.
